Swiss singer songwriter, musician and creative dreamer Luna Oku pushes evocative buttons. On "Sleep Well", you have no time to acclimate yourself to Oku's aesthetic as the song seems to start in mid stride. Instantly you are pulled into flowing bass lines, dreamy synths and guitar ascensions and Oku's most intimate instrument, his voice. The wanderlust journey has bass / beat percolations and wonderful fall aways when the beat stops and you float on bare instrumentation and Oku's vocal melodies moving smoothly from middle tones to high falsettos. At one point, when everything expands and erupts, Oku's self harmonies feel utterly sublime. Other surprising transitions lift you up and sometimes sideways as the sounds shift from dense puzzle pieces to minimalistic frames as Oku's vocals penetrate even more darkly tender. I love the intimate approach. There is the feeling of indie rock and post punk plunges feeling progressive but simple too, if that makes any sense at all.
